The action RPG The Chosen: Well of Souls (originally released as Frater) was developed by Rebelmind and launched in 2006–2007. While it is no longer available on mainstream digital storefronts like Steam or Epic Games, it has seen several historical and niche distribution methods. 1. Availability and Download Options
Because the game is considered "abandonware" or legacy software, official digital purchase options are extremely limited.
Historical Free Release: The developers reportedly released the game as a free title in 2015.
Archive Sources: Fully playable versions and disc images (ISO) are hosted on community archival sites like the Internet Archive (Frater EU) and the Internet Archive (USA Version).
Legacy Game Repositories: It is also listed on specialized sites such as Old-Games.com, which hosts a ~400 MB download. 2. Game Overview
Setting: A dark, 19th-century world where players must stop the sorcerer Marcus Dominus Ingens from summoning demons using the souls of alchemists.
Classes: Players can choose from three archetypes: Frater Simon (Mage/Monk), Elena (Hunter/Thief), and Tong Wong (Warrior).
Gameplay Style: It is a traditional "Diablo-clone" featuring hack-and-slash combat, loot collection, and the ability to control summoned golems or demons.
Unique Mechanic: A notable feature is the ability to teleport back to the home base instantly at any time, which reviewers noted lowered the overall difficulty and tension. 3. System Requirements

Set at the dawn of the 19th century, the game blends Gothic horror with early industrial steampunk elements. The plot follows a sinister sorcerer who seeks to achieve immortality by harvesting souls from the legendary "Well of Souls." Players choose between three distinct heroes: The Warrior: A master of melee combat and heavy armor.
The Hunter: A specialist in firearms and long-range precision. The Alchemist: A wielder of magic and mystical arts.
The gameplay follows the classic "Diablo-clone" formula: explore dark forests and ancient ruins, click through hordes of supernatural enemies, and collect vast amounts of loot to upgrade your character. Where to Find a Digital Download

Downloading the game is only half the battle. Older games often struggle with modern hardware and high-resolution monitors. Here are a few tips to get The Chosen running smoothly:
Compatibility Mode: After downloading, right-click the game’s .exe file, go to Properties > Compatibility, and set it to run for "Windows XP (Service Pack 3)." Revisiting a Gothic Classic: The Chosen: Well of
Run as Administrator: Many older games require administrative privileges to save progress correctly.
DirectX Wrappers: If you experience flickering or crashes, tools like dgVoodoo2 can wrap the game’s old DirectX calls into modern API calls, allowing for better performance and higher resolutions. Why Play it Today?
